How Reliable is the Mitsubishi Outlander?

Based on 726,436 MOT tests across 75,074 vehicles.

80.9%
Pass Rate
8,010
Miles/Year
22
Year Lifespan
75,074
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 4,278
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 4,050
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 4,007
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 3,610

BG10 HJE is a 2010 Mitsubishi Outlander in Black with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.

Across all 2010 Mitsubishi Outlander models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.7% with a typical mileage of 87,858 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mitsubishi Outlander f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,278 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BG10 HJE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mitsubishi Outlander typ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 16 years old, this Mitsubishi Outlander is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
